We got takeout from P. F. Chang's this year for New Year's Eve, and it was an overall good experience. P. F. Chang's has a lovely atmosphere, so I don't generally recommend getting food to go, but in this case, we just wanted a quiet evening at home. Our order took over an hour to be ready, which we didn't expect, but for a major holiday I guess that makes sense. I appreciate that the restaurant has a kids' meal option, which our daughter enjoyed. As for myself, I decided to try the miso lobster dumplings, and they were exquisite! That miso butter is the perfect complement to the dumplings.

Came on a Saturday and it was quite busy. Took about 30-45 min to be seated. The inside is very nice I love the decor. Started off with crispy chili garlic green beans. These are a MUST. The lettuce wraps were okay, they weren't as great as I remembered. Crab hand folded wontons were also okay, they were a little bland and the sauce didn't really complement them in my opinion. We tried to order sushi but they were all out which was unfortunate! Ended up getting dynamite shrimp which was actually really good! Other favorite dish was the short rib kimchi fried rice. Definitely has a a good flavor! I really enjoyed most of the things we got here. At first I thought the menu wasn't big enough but they ended up having really good options. One thing to note is that the dishes are family style, so be sure to keep that in mind when ordered. We over ordered on food! But it was all pretty delicious!

We came here on a Wednesday night at 5:30 & got seated right away. The server was friendly & helpful . We ordered the Mongolian Beef this was delicious! The beef was crispy but not breaded. It has a really good sauce & came with a lot of broccoli. The broccoli was under cooked & some of the pieces were huge it could have been cut up better . We also got the signature combo low mein . This was really good it had chicken , pork , beef & shrimp . The mushrooms were really good . It has quite a bit of meat . The noodles were really good . It could have used a bit more sauce but adding soy sauce made it good . We paid $4 extra for the fried rice this is good but I think brown or white rice would be just as good . The service was good ! They have Coke products although they were out of Coke Zero . We would definitely eat here again. They forgot to give us our fortune cookies at the end of our meal . We didn't realize it until we got home .
